Provincial Fleets Organisation
Provincial Fleets were established to provide a permanent naval
presence in specific provinces away from Italy.
Eventually they comprised :-
Classis Alexandrina - based in Egypt
Classis Britannica - based around Britain
Classis Germanica - based along the North Sea and Rhine river system.
Classis Moesica - based on the lower Danube and north coast of the Black Sea
Classis Nova Libica - based on the African coast
Classis Pannonica - based on the middle and upper Danube
Classis Pontica - based in the south and east of the Black Sea
Classis Syriaca - based in the eastern Mediterranean
The first provincial fleet was established by Augustus, the Classis
Alexandrina, based at Alexandria to secure the grain supply from Egypt.
